Depleted Uranium

The Upper Hudson Peace Action firmly opposes the use of radioactive wastes or other associated and dangerous radioactive materials for deployment or integration into conventional weapons. Since 1945, the United States has irradiated New Mexico, Hiroshima, Nagasaki, Nevada, Utah, most of the Midwest and East Coast, and the South Pacific, with fallout from fission bombs, has irradiated California, Texas, Maryland, and Puerto Rico with depleted uranium testing, and has dropped large amounts of radioactive materials on Iraq, Bosnia, Kosovo, Afghanistan, Kuwait, and Saudi Arabia. The military continues to irresponsibly and dangerously deploy nuclear materials, by using depleted uranium to make bullets, bunker busters, missiles, and other munitions.

To respond to this inhumanity, the Upper Hudson Peace Action works closely with the ongoing ongoing campaign of the Depleted Uranium Weapons Network to educate people on the realities of depleted uranium use in American military operations.
